Körbar UML - Executable UML - qaz.wiki

2553

Mms Västerås - Fox On Green

INTRODUCTION This document presents the semantics of the Unified Modeling Language (UML). These semantics are specified using a formal textual description together with a metamodel describing the constituents of all well-formed models that may be represented in the UML, using the UML itself. The Foundational UML Subset (fUML) is an executable subset of standard UML that can be used to define, in an operational style, the structural and behavioral semantics of systems. It may also be used to define MOF-based modeling languages such as standard UML or its subsets and extensions. For example, the semantics of UML state machines can be 2021-02-18 Such semantics is required in order to ensure that UML concepts are precisely stated and defined. In this paper we motivate an approach to formalizing UML in which formal specification techniques UML Core Elements. UML specification has the Kernel package which provides the core modeling concepts of the UML, including element, named element, namespace, relationship, directed relationship, classifier, comment, etc.

  1. Bra immunforsvar
  2. Aldershot las cruces nm
  3. Fordringsrätt sammanfattning
  4. Uppkörning bil trafikverket

Semantics of activity diagrams. Verification of UML models. State invariants Given a formal definition of UML’s semantics in the above framework, the semantics of a model is defined as follows. Definition 1.1 (Descriptive semantics of a model) The descriptive semanticsofa model M under the hypothesis H is [[M]] H = AxmD ∪T(M)∪H(M). A key concept of the semantics of modelling languages is the satisfaction of a model by a system. OMG RFP “Action Semantics for UML” focuses exclusively on the action semantics.

Uml Blackboard Login - Ludo Stor Gallery from 2021

The second part actually goes into specifying the UML Semantics– defines UML’s semantics. Introduction to UML 16! Building blocks! Well-formedness rules Foundation Concepts.

UML 2 And The Unified Process 9780321321275

Uml semantics

Defining precise semantics for UML. Jean-Michel Bruel, Johan Lilius, Ana Moreira, Robert B. France. Forskningsoutput: Kapitel i bok/konferenshandling › Kapitel  Jämför och hitta det billigaste priset på UML 2 Semantics and Applications innan du gör ditt köp. Köp som antingen bok, ljudbok eller e-bok. Läs mer och skaffa  To tailor semantics variability the notion of semantic variation point has been introduced in UML 2.0.

Uml semantics

of Measurement and Information Systems, Budapest University of Technology and Economics Se hela listan på tutorialspoint.com 2.4 UML Semantics 30 2.5 Applications of Semantics to UML 35 2.6 Application of Semantics to the Use of UML 38 2.7 Summary 39 3 CONSIDERATIONS AND RATIONALE FOR A UML SYSTEM MODEL 43 Manfred Broy, María Victoria Cengarle, Hans Grönniger, and Bernhard Rumpe 3.1 Introduction 43 3.2 GeneralApproach to Semantics 43 3.3 Structuring the Semantics IntroductionThe UML 2 Semantics Project is an international collaboration, involving both academia and industry. Participants include IBM (Canada, Germany, and Israel), Queen's University (Kingston, Ontario, Canada), the Technical University of Munich (Germany), and the Technical University of Braunschweig (Germany). Precise UML Semantics Jeffrey Smith1, Scott DeLoach2, Mieczyslaw Kokar3 and Ken Baclawski3 1 Mercury Computer Systems Inc. 2 Northeastern University 3 Air Force Institute of Technology 1 Introduction There have been a number of formal approaches for specifying UML semantics [2–4,8–11]. UML and its semantics Introduction to OCL Specifying requirements with OCL Modelling of Systems with Formal Semantics Propositional & First-order logic, sequent calculus OCL to Logic, horizontal proof obligations, using KeY Dynamic logic, proving program correctness Java Card DL Vertical proof obligations, using KeY Wrap-up, trends We provide a rigorous semantics for one of the central diagram types which are used in UML for the description of dynamical system behavior, namely activity diagrams.
Utbildning vvs ingenjör

UML-syntax Lennart Andersson Datavetenskap, LTH 20 januari 2013 1 UML r en grafisk notation fr utformning och beskrivning av objektorienterade system. Computational Syntax and Semantics: Lexical Syntax and  C# 1: Basic Syntax and Semantics The Unified Modelling Language (UML), Agile Programming and Test Driven The Unified Modelling Language (UML) av E Volodina · 2008 · Citerat av 6 — UML scheme for the module on Swedish Vocabulary Size Test.

Building blocks!
Vanliga svenska ostar

teoriprov hur ser det ut
master degree in marketing
vad betyder amal
arytmi,
lån utan uc 50000
stuckatorvagen
sa bill of rights pdf

9780470409084 UML 2 Semantics and Applications

In this work, UML class diagrams based on the Common Information Model (CIM) standard are used to describe the semantics of the electrical power grid.